I think when people mention original tamas they mean the first tamagotchis to be launched. (P1s/P2s).

Those were the original tamagotchis (the first) - also often called 1st generation or Gen1. And anyone who was into them when they were originally launched could be described as an "original tama" fan.

I don't think the intention is to somehow use the word "original" to suggest that they're better than other tama fans who discovered tamas when the V1s or later versions were launched - only that they were fans of the first tamas launched back in 1997.

So, I think it's a misunderstanding of what "original" means in this context.
